Output 73d393ab3abec01d098d080b23cd95a75cce07a7ae41c7d9498bbb3f48ebdda7:0

value
933034420
script pubkey
OP_0 OP_PUSHBYTES_20 bf3acf2a1bda618428db5abe242cf67b217dc0b8
address
bc1qhuav72smmfscg2xmt2lzgt8k0vshms9cqpj3zx
transaction
73d393ab3abec01d098d080b23cd95a75cce07a7ae41c7d9498bbb3f48ebdda7
spent
true